简要总结
This is a prospective, open label pilot study in which patients with symptoms of acute or chronic pouchitis will receive FMT therapy delivered via pouchoscopy. The investigators hypothesize that FMT is a safe and effective treatment for patients with pouchitis. Our aims our:
- To determine if symptoms of pouchitis can be successfully treated by Fecal Microbial Transplantation.
- To determine if endoscopic appearance of ileal pouch improves following treatment by Fecal Microbial Transplantation.

入选标准
- •Both acute and chronic pouchitis will be eligible for treatment with FMT. Patients eligible for FMT will include:
- •Patients with history of proctocolectomy with IPAA with pouchitis confirmed by endoscopy and pathology.
- •Concurrent therapies with mesalamine, immunomodulators, corticosteroids and biologic agents will be allowed to continue during study.
排除标准
- •Female patients who are pregnant.
- •Patients with severe immunosuppression (absolute neutrophil count < 1000 or CD4 count <200).
- •Patients with diagnosis of ileal Crohn's Disease.
- •Patients with untreated enteric infection.
- •Patients with fistulizing disease.
- •Patients with gastroparesis or dysphagia will not be eligible for the arm of the study allowing for administration of weekly capsules
研究组 & 干预措施
Pouchitis patients receiving FMT
Pouchitis patients receiving biologically active human fecal material sourced from OpenBiome.The physician will administer 250 mL of the fecal suspension in aliquots of 50-60 mL through the endoscope. The material will be delivered to the most proximal point of insertion.
干预措施: Biologically active human fecal material, OpenBiome (Drug)
结局指标
主要结局
Clinical improvement of pouchitis
时间窗: 4 weeks
In order to assess clinical improvement of pouchitis, patients will be scheduled for a 4 week post-FMT treatment clinic visit to ensure no adverse events have occurred and to assess patient symptoms. Patients will also complete a survey both before and after treatment to evaluate the efficacy of FMT treatment.
